2024 Zoo detroit - At the Detroit Zoo Binti, whose name means “daughter” in Swahili, was born on Sept. 10, 2020. She is the first lion born at the Detroit Zoo since 1980. Her mother Asha and aunt Amirah, born in 2016 at another zoo, joined the Detroit Zoo pride in May 2019. Binti’s father Simba, a male once owned by the royal family of Qatar, found his new ...

The Detroit Zoo’s 125 acres feature award-winning attractions such as the National Amphibian Conservation Center, Great Apes of Harambee and Arctic Ring of Life. The newest attraction – the 33,000-square-foot Polk Penguin Conservation Center – is the largest facility for penguins in the world. Sunset will provide guests with a sensational evening that includes delicious cuisine, delectable drinks, live ...1928 – Detroit Zoo opens to the public on August 1. Habitats include bear dens, lion dens, bird house, elk yard, raccoon and wolverine habitats, African veldt and completely stocked lakes. 1928 – Zoo closes on December 3 for the winter, having entertained 1.5 million visitors in its first four months. 1930-32 – New animals and habitats ... Detroit Zoo and Belle Isle Nature Center. At the Detroit Zoo The Detroit Zoo is home to three rescued bald eagles. Male Flash was found on Kodiak Island, Alaska in September 2008, after suffering a wing injury that prevented him from being released back into the wild. He arrived at the Detroit Zoo in November 2009. Discover how the Detroit Zoological Society (DZS) supports exciting conservation projects, as this year’s event features a groundbreaking initiative to restore South Africa’s vulture …A second attempt to establish a zoo was made in 1911, when several prominent Detroiters organized the Detroit Zoological Society and began planning for a world-class zoo. After several false starts, the Zoological Society eventually bought property just north of 10 Mile Road along Woodward Avenue. Renowned designer Heinrich Hagenbeck of Hamburg ... Parking. $8.00.
